But similar to Mariah’s fashionable Christmas bop, poinsettias are economically important – they’re the highest promoting potted plant in the world. In the course of the holiday season, the six weeks leading up to Christmas, $250 million price of poinsettia plants – 70 million plants – are sold within the United States alone, and the plants are much more widespread in Europe. There are over 100 totally different kinds of poinsettia plant patented in the United States. Poinsettias have been cultivated by the Aztecs, and although they did not grow in the capital city of Tenochtitlan – now Mexico City – Aztec royalty imported the flowers from decrease elevations through the winter months for use as a medication to regulate fevers and as a reddish-purple fabric dye. The Nahua folks of Mexico and Central America name these Aztec favorites cuetlaxochitl, but they go by many other names, too – lobster flower, flame leaf flower, La Flor de la Nochebuena” (Christmas Eve flower).
But “poinsettia” might be the weirdest name of all because it’s only a shout out to the American diplomat who is credited with being the first to convey them back to the U.S. Mexico in the 19th century. Joel Roberts Poinsett was the first U.S. Mexico, and as an amateur botanist, is claimed to have sent some cuttings again to his residence in South Carolina from Southern Mexico in 1928, although there is no such thing as a irrefutable proof of this. The plant was instantly widespread and was recognized henceforth because the “poinsettia,” though it didn’t obtain its official Latin name until 1934 when German botanist Karl Willde was given a chopping by a Scottish pal who had seen it in Philadelphia and named it Euphorbia pulcherrima. In the 1920s the Ecke household of Encinitas, California began farming poinsettias, and so they tirelessly pushed them as a symbol of the Christmas season. Today, round 70 percent of the poinsettia plants you purchase within the United States come from Ecke Ranch, and poinsettia care is their lifeblood. Poinsettias hail from the mid-elevation areas of Mexico and Central America, where they’ll grow over 10 ft (three meters) tall as a perennial winter-flowering shrub with milky sap and branches so lengthy they generally appear like vines. The large, showy purple, white or pink flowers we’re used to seeing aren’t actually the poinsettia’s flowers at all, however modified leaves referred to as bracts. The flower buds are the small yellow buds in the middle of the colorful bracts. When you purchase a poinsettia at the grocery retailer, it comes already sporting its brightly colored, fancy bracts. You have no idea how hard it was to get them there.
Flood fill, also referred to as seed fill, is a flooding algorithm that determines and alters the world related to a given node in a multi-dimensional array with some matching attribute. It is used in the “bucket” fill device of paint programs to fill connected, similarly-coloured areas with a special coloration, and in games equivalent to Go and Minesweeper for determining which pieces are cleared. A variant referred to as boundary fill uses the same algorithms however is defined as the area connected to a given node that does not have a specific attribute. Note that flood filling just isn’t appropriate for drawing crammed polygons, as it should miss some pixels in additional acute corners. Instead, see Even-odd rule and Nonzero-rule. The normal flood-fill algorithm takes three parameters: a start node, a target colour, and a alternative color. The algorithm appears to be like for all nodes within the array that are linked to the beginning node by a path of the goal colour and changes them to the alternative shade.
For a boundary-fill, in place of the target coloration, a border colour can be supplied. In an effort to generalize the algorithm in the common way, the following descriptions will as an alternative have two routines out there. One called Inside which returns true for unfilled factors that, by their coloration, could be contained in the crammed area, and one referred to as Set which fills a pixel/node. Any node that has Set known as on it should then not be Inside. Depending on whether or not we consider nodes touching at the corners connected or not, we now have two variations: eight-means and 4-way respectively. Though easy to grasp, the implementation of the algorithm used above is impractical in languages and environments where stack space is severely constrained (e.g. Microcontrollers). Moving the recursion into an information structure (both a stack or a queue) prevents a stack overflow. Check and set each node’s pixel color earlier than adding it to the stack/queue, decreasing stack/queue measurement.